- Sandro RukhadzeJan 30, 2025 · 10 months agoOne common scam in the crypto space is phishing, where scammers try to trick people into revealing their private keys or passwords through fake websites or emails. It's important to always double-check the URL and be cautious of unsolicited emails asking for personal information. Another common scam is Ponzi schemes, where scammers promise high returns on investments but use new investors' money to pay off earlier investors. It's important to do thorough research and be skeptical of any investment that sounds too good to be true. In addition, there are fake ICOs (Initial Coin Offerings) where scammers create fake projects and tokens to raise money from unsuspecting investors. It's crucial to carefully evaluate the legitimacy of any ICO before investing. Lastly, there are pump and dump schemes, where scammers artificially inflate the price of a cryptocurrency through false information and then sell their holdings at the peak, causing the price to crash. It's important to be cautious of sudden price spikes and do thorough research before investing in any cryptocurrency.

- Rifle DragonMar 11, 2025 · 8 months agoAs an expert in the crypto space, I've seen many scams come and go. One important scam to watch out for is fake giveaways. Scammers often impersonate well-known figures in the crypto community and claim to be giving away free cryptocurrency. They ask for a small amount of cryptocurrency as a 'processing fee' or 'verification fee' and then disappear with the funds. Another scam to be cautious of is fake wallets. Scammers create fake wallet apps that look legitimate but are designed to steal your private keys and access your funds. Always download wallets from official sources and double-check the app's reviews and ratings. Lastly, be cautious of social media scams. Scammers often create fake accounts and promote fraudulent investment opportunities or ICOs. Always verify the authenticity of the account and do thorough research before investing.
